Job Summary/Purpose
All members of Entergy's safety function will be expected to own safety, work to prevent incidents and seek to improve with the understanding that zero harm is possible. This position is tasked with examining the workplace/worksite for environmental or physical factors that could affect employee and/or contract partner health, safety, comfort, and performance. Ensuring the workplace/worksite is as safe as possible is accomplished through conducting risk assessments, safety analyses, job site reviews, and coaching. This position is specific to vegetation management and asset management.
Job Duties/Responsibilities
- Collaborate with key stakeholders to ensure effective implementation of safety programs in accordance with management system elements.
- Conduct training as necessary to ensure applicable rules, procedures, and expectations are understood.
- Conduct engagements and observations with employees and contract partners providing immediate coaching on safe and unsafe conditions observed.
- Conduct field and site inspections, document deficiencies, and develop sustainable solutions to prevent repeat findings.
- Participate in the incident investigation process including root cause analysis and identification of corrective actions.
- Reinforce safe work expectations in accordance with applicable laws, rules, procedures, and expectations.
- Review safety related data and metrics to identify trends and recommend corrective actions to address any issues identified.
- Stop work if there is any unsafe condition.
